Understanding Help to Buy Valuations in LS10 1

A Help to Buy valuation is specifically required when you want to make changes to your Help to Buy equity loan, whether that involves making a partial repayment, remortgaging to a new lender, or reaching the end of your initial five-year interest-free period. The valuation must be carried out by a RICS registered valuer and follows the RICS Red Book valuation standards, ensuring the report is accepted by the Help to Buy Agency and your mortgage lender.

Frequently Asked Questions About Help to Buy Valuations

What is a Help to Buy valuation and why do I need one?

A Help to Buy valuation is a RICS Red Book compliant valuation required by the Help to Buy Agency when you want to make changes to your equity loan, such as partial repayment, remortgaging, or at the end of your initial interest-free period. In LS10 1, this valuation must be carried out by a registered valuer to ensure compliance with the scheme requirements. The valuation determines the current market value of your property, which directly affects how much equity you can repay or how much you may be able to borrow if remortgaging.

Can I remortgage my Help to Buy property after getting a valuation?

Yes, you can remortgage your Help to Buy property. The valuation will determine your current property value, which helps your new lender calculate the loan-to-value ratio. However, you will need to maintain your Help to Buy equity loan or arrange to repay it as part of the remortgage process. Do I need a survey as well as a valuation?

A Help to Buy valuation focuses solely on determining the market value of your property for equity loan purposes, while a survey assesses the condition of the property and identifies any defects. If you are concerned about the condition of your LS10 1 property, particularly if it is an older terraced property or a newer build, we recommend arranging a RICS Level 2 or Level 3 survey in addition to your valuation. This can help you identify any maintenance issues that may affect the property's value or require attention.
